So, who is this client you might ask?

Our client has very quickly become synonymous with high-quality activewear, that regardless of size, shape, or stage of life, they’ll have something fabulous for everyone.

They were founded in Brisbane by two gals who became friends over baby playdates and long pram walks in search of coffee. Together, they navigated returning to exercise post babies and the many changes their bodies experienced over this time. They both felt pretty frustrated with buying activewear online and receiving products that looked beautiful on models but didn’t perform in real-life.

So? They decided to take matters into their own hands and launched in 2016.

Here’s what you’ll be getting up to:

  • Creating and developing digital-first creative that aligns with the brand aesthetic and is optimised for digital performance across Instagram, Facebook, and TikTok;
  • Creating copy and content for organic and paid channels and producing engaging copy for blogs, email, Youtube, and the web. From a social perspective, this will include a heck of a lot of copywriting, scheduling, posting, and community management;
  • Engaging and growing the social community in meaningful ways, nurturing and expanding upon the strong customer relationships that are already in place;
  • Working with the wider marketing team to help identify and nurture social ambassadors to grow brand awareness and audience;
  • Ensuring that all channels are constantly evolving and leveraging new opportunities, technology, and trends;
  • Review results and make changes to the marketing plan as needed; And
  • Consistently monitor and stay abreast of current trends online.
